Safety
Make sure that the bunk bed you choose has all of the safety features recommended by experts. To prevent falls look for rails that are at least 5 inches high above the mattress surface. Ladders must be secured and have steps that are stable for climbing to the top. Mattresses should be snugly seated within the frame to avoid gaps that could create dangers of entanglement. Make sure the ladder is located away from the footboard and headboard so that children can't use it as a play area or for roughhousing, jumping or jumping. Finaly, bunk beds should face two perpendicular walls to limit the number of possible sides from which children could fall.
Once you have put up the bunk bed, it is important that you educate your children about its use and safety. They should be aware that the ladder is only meant to go up and down. They should also understand that they shouldn't put anything on their beds. It is best to review these rules frequently so your children don't forget them or start to ignore them.
You can enhance the safety of your bunk bed by adding additional features or accessories. Consider adding an extension for the guardrail to the bottom bunk or a non-slip step on the ladder. You could also include a nightlight on the top bunk to ensure security at night.
In the end, it is crucial to inspect the bunk bed frequently to make sure that all its components and pieces are in working in good working order. If you spot any signs of wear or wear, they must be repaired immediately. This is especially crucial for the ladder, as it will be subjected to a lot of use and could be prone to falling off or damaged. It is also a good idea to regularly check if the guard rails are secure and that they don't have any gaps or openings that can trap a child's head or limbs, as required by safety standards.
